Next Amani is located in Kenya, Nairobi. A vibrant environment designed for over 250,000 residents. The project was developed in collaboration with Spectrum Architecture. Next residential complex consists of 4 individual blocks. All of them have different height and create a distinct silhouette. There are two main entrance points, each for two residential blocks. This means that single elevator/stair core is servicing two blocks. In total there are 3 elevators and 3 staircases for each pair of buildings, from these 2-passenger elevator and 1 cargo elevator. The building consists of several occupancies, such as residential areas, public areas, technical areas, parking and etc. For public areas we have a dedicated space for signature restaurant, which has a separate entrance from B1 level and continues up to ground floor. In addition to that there are a couple of commercial areas located on ground floor. They also have a separate entrance from the alleyway, which connects main entrance to the backyard and beyond, to the public recreational park. Between blocks 01 & 02 and 03 & 04 there are cozy courtyards, which are also leading to the backyard and beyond.
